UK Parliament Tackles 'Stop Killing Games' Petition

The UK Parliament recently debated the 'Stop Killing Games' petition, which has nearly 190,000 signatures. The campaign calls for laws that would require game publishers to offer offline capabilities or community support when servers shut down. While Minister Stephanie Peacock believes current laws suffice, she acknowledged the challenges and potential fallout of new regulations. As the conversation continues, the future of digital gaming and ownership rights is becoming a hot topic among lawmakers.
